The A/C Compressor of the Hyundai Accent is the centerpiece of the cooling loop that ensures cabin comfort on hot days. The A/C Compressor works like a small pump, pulling low pressure vapor in through the inlet. The A/C Compressor then squeezes the gas into high pressure, high temperature gas, which is sent off to the condenser. Cool outside airflow strips the heat from the gas in the condensing process. When the refrigerant cools down and changes back to liquid, it moves to the evaporator. Here it expands and absorbs heat from inside the cabin. The A/C Compressor then restarts the cycle to blow out more cold air.
